The brands under BBK Electronics, namely OnePlus, Oppo, and Realme, are on the verge of making a significant technological leap for their high-end smartphone models. This development marks a significant stride towards enhancing user experience and security.
At the heart of this upcoming change lies the integration of ultrasonic fingerprint sensors, which will replace the traditional biometric authentication methods used in their flagship devices. Such a move is poised to redefine user interaction by offering a more seamless and efficient unlocking mechanism.
Historically, biometric authentication in smartphones has largely relied on optical sensors that capture 2D images of the fingerprint. However, the shift towards ultrasonic technology signifies a pursuit for greater accuracy and security.
The adoption of Goodix’s cutting-edge single-point ultrasonic fingerprint scanner technology underscores the brands' commitment to leveraging sophisticated technologies for improving user convenience.
These ultrasonic sensors are capable of capturing a 3D representation of the fingerprint, providing a more detailed and secure authentication compared to the 2D image-based methods. This advancement is expected to significantly reduce the chances of unauthorized access, thereby fortifying the smartphones' security framework.
